The Essential Guide To Choosing The Perfect Table Lamps

Consider Your Space

1. Size and Scale: The first step in selecting a table lamp is to consider the size of your space. A lamp that is too small may get lost on a large table, while one that is too big can overwhelm a small space. As a general rule, the bottom of the lampshade should be at eye level when you’re seated. This ensures optimal lighting and visual appeal.

2. Style: Table lamps come in various styles, from modern and minimalist to traditional and ornate. Consider the overall decor of your room. For a contemporary look, choose sleek designs with clean lines. If your space has a vintage vibe, look for lamps with intricate details or antique finishes.

Lighting Needs

1. Functionality: Think about how you plan to use your table lamp. If it’s for reading, opt for a lamp with adjustable brightness or a focused light source. For ambient lighting, choose a lamp that diffuses light softly throughout the room.

2. Bulb Type: The type of bulb you use can significantly affect the quality of light. LED bulbs are energy-efficient and long-lasting, while incandescent bulbs provide a warm, cozy glow. Consider the color temperature as well; warmer tones create a relaxing atmosphere, while cooler tones can be more energizing.

Material and Design

1. Base Material: Table lamps come in various materials, including metal, ceramic, glass, and wood. Each material offers a different aesthetic and durability. Metal bases tend to be more modern, while wooden bases can add warmth and texture to your decor.

2. Lampshade Choices: The lampshade can dramatically affect the lamp’s overall look and the quality of light it produces. Shades come in various shapes, sizes, and materials, from fabric to glass. Light-colored shades tend to diffuse light better, while dark shades can create a more intimate setting.

Placement Tips

1. Strategic Positioning: Place your table lamps in areas where you need additional light, such as beside a sofa, on a bedside table, or in a reading nook. Ensure they are easily accessible for turning on and off.

2. Layering Light: For a well-lit room, consider using multiple light sources, including overhead lighting, floor lamps, and table lamps. This layering creates a dynamic and inviting atmosphere.
